Abstract
1488212 Esters of polyoxyalkylenes DOW CHEMICAL CO 20 Feb 1975 [20 Feb 1974 2 May 1974 (2)] 7213/75 Heading C2C [Also in Division C3] Esters have the formula wherein R is the residue after removal of n active hydrogen atoms from an initiator, RH n ; each R<SP>1</SP> is independently ethylene, trimethylene, tetramethylene, 1,2 - butylene, 2,2 - bis- (halomethyl) - 1,3 - propylene, phenylethylene or A being H, Cl, Br or OX; each X is independently H or the acyl radical of a carboxylic acid. There is a proviso that at least one R1 is 3- hydroxy-1,2-propylene and at least one R<SP>1</SP> is where X is the acyl radical of a carboxylic acid; m and n are integers such that the total number of R<SP>1</SP>O groups is at least 2. Typical initiators are water, alkylene glycols, glycerol, or bisphenol A. The compounds may be prepared by reacting a tert-alkyl glycidyl ether with initiator to prepare a polymer or copolymer (cf. Specification 1,267,259) and reacting further with a carboxylic acid or the anhydride or acyl halide thereof in the presence of a strong acid catalyst, e.g. an arylsulphonic acid. In an example triethylene glycol is reacted with a 50/50 molar mixture of tert-butyl glycidyl ether and propylene oxide and the resultant oligomer dealkylated and esterified with acrylic acid using an arylsulphonic acid catalyst.
